Which of the following sounds has а higher pitch: a car horn or a guitar?
Advertisements
Solution
The frequency of the vibration of a sound produced by a guitar is greater than that produced by a car horn. Since the pitch of a sound is proportional to its frequency, the guitar has a higher pitch than a car horn.
